  4. Oxidation that bad, ehh? Your gonna have to remove it via a fine wire wheel, fine steel wool, or a scothbrite pad and then re polish the aluminum after the white oxidation is gone. You might find bad pitting underneath..
  5. Wash wheel thoroughly to get brake dust off. Then use the nevrdull cotton wadding shit and elbow grease. The stuff I had was made by eagle 1 but I think Neverdull also has its own brand. Just check the spelling on Nevrdull.
